Pedestrian Railing Type PR3
Pedestrian Railing Type PR3
Classification | Pedestrian |
Description | 2-ft-wide concrete posts spaced a maximum of 12 ft apart. Between the concrete posts there are two steel pipe rails centered 42 inches and 13.5 inches from the sidewalk surface with vertical steel pickets connected to the steel pipe rails. A 6- inch-tall concrete curb is placed between the concrete posts. |
Approved test criteria and level | The PR3 railing is designed for pedestrian loads only. It has not been crash-tested, and it is not intended for exposure to traffic. If this railing is used on a bridge or culvert, it must be protected from vehicular impact by an approved bridge rail type. |
Nominal height | 43.75 inches |
Minimum height after maintenance overlays | 42 inches |
Special notes | The PR3-HD is to be used with this railing when an ADAcompliant handrail is needed. |
